Transaction 841e9197f764c2351a52897921adf7f3f8700729e7ff0d24f789ed54a0f64b97

150 Input
2 Outputs
  • 841e9197f764c2351a52897921adf7f3f8700729e7ff0d24f789ed54a0f64b97:0
  • value  939662
    address  3C75sJSwRL9eKzJkV5am78PjsJa3xYbbqa
  • 841e9197f764c2351a52897921adf7f3f8700729e7ff0d24f789ed54a0f64b97:1
  • value  463786117
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s